Recipe preparation

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Fresh Peaches: Select ripe peaches for maximum sweetness; they should yield slightly when squeezed gently.

  • Brown Sugar: Use light brown sugar for a subtle caramel flavor that complements the fruit perfectly.

  • All-Purpose Flour: Regular all-purpose flour works best for achieving the right texture in your cake.

  • Baking Powder: Ensure it’s fresh to guarantee a fluffy rise and light texture.

  • Unsalted Butter: Always use unsalted butter to control the saltiness; let it soften at room temperature before using.

  • Eggs: Room temperature eggs blend better into the batter, contributing to a smoother texture.

  • Vanilla Extract: Pure vanilla extract enhances the overall flavor; avoid imitation versions if possible.

  • Milk: Whole milk adds richness; however, you can substitute dairy-free options if needed.

Let’s Make it Together

Creating your Brown Sugar Peach Cake is an enjoyable experience that combines simple steps with delightful results. Let’s roll up our sleeves and get started!

Preheat and Prepare Your Pan: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ease an 8-inch round cake pan with butter or nonstick spray to ensure easy removal later.

Mix the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and a pinch of salt until well combined. This will prevent clumps in your batter.

Cream Butter and Sugar: In a large mixing bowl, beat softened but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y—about 3-4 minutes. This step introduces air into your mixture for a tender cake.

Add Eggs and Vanilla: Beat in eggs one at a time along with vanilla extract until fully incorporated. The batter should look smooth and creamy at this stage.

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ures: Gradually add the dry mixture to your wet ingredients while alternating with milk. Mix until just combined; be careful not to overmix or risk toughening your cake.

Add Peaches and Bake!: Gently fold in chopped peaches until evenly distributed throughout the batter. Pour into prepared pan and smooth out the top.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own—test doneness by inserting a toothpick which should come out clean!

FAQ

Can I use frozen peaches in my Brown Sugar Peach Cake?

Yes, but thaw and drain them first to avoid excess moisture in the batter.

What makes this cake different from regular peach cakes?

The use of brown sugar adds depth and caramel notes that elevate the flavor beautifully.

How can I enhance the flavor of my Brown Sugar Peach Cake?

Add a s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g to the batter for a warm spice kick!

Brown Sugar Peach Cake

  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: Approximately 10 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ups fresh peaches, chopped
  • 1 cup light brown sugar
  • 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• ½ cup whole milk

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8-inch round cake pan.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and a pinch of salt. Set aside.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, cream the softened but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y (about 3-4 minutes).
  4. Beat in the eggs one at a time along with vanilla extract until smooth.
  5.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, alternating with milk until just combined.
  6. Gently fold in the chopped peaches and pour into the prepared pan.
  7.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own. Test doneness with a toothpick.
